#bfe5ec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bfe5ec is composed of 74.9% red, 89.8% green and 92.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.1% cyan, 3%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 189.3 degrees, a saturation of 54.2% and a lightness of 83.7%. #bfe5ec color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#7fcbd9.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

Shades and Tints of #bfe5ec

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030a0c is the darkest color, while #fcf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#bfe5ec

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d5d6d6 is the less saturated color, while #aff0fc is the most saturated one.
